Core Categories of Casino Bonuses
Welcome bonuses represent the most common starting point for new accounts, and they often combine deposit matches with free spins on selected slots, whereas no-deposit bonuses allow limited play without initial funding yet carry stricter withdrawal caps. Deposit match offers scale with the amount transferred, so a 100 percent match up to a set limit doubles the first deposit while free spin allocations provide fixed numbers of rounds on designated titles. Loyalty programs accumulate points through ongoing activity, and these points convert into cashback, exclusive bonuses, or event invitations once players reach defined tiers.
High-roller incentives target larger deposits with enhanced match percentages and reduced wagering multipliers, yet operators apply these selectively based on verified transaction history. Cashback promotions return a percentage of net losses over a period, and reload bonuses activate on subsequent deposits to sustain activity between major promotions. Tournament entries and leaderboard rewards add competitive layers where bonus credits or prizes distribute according to performance metrics.
Wagering Requirements and Eligibility Rules
Wagering requirements specify the multiple of bonus funds that must be bet before any winnings become eligible for withdrawal, and common thresholds range from 20x to 50x depending on the bonus type and jurisdiction. Game contribution rates vary, with slots often counting at 100 percent while table games such as blackjack or roulette contribute at lower percentages or face exclusion from bonus playthrough. Time limits on bonus validity usually span 7 to 30 days, after which unused portions expire and associated winnings forfeit.
Geographic restrictions limit availability based on player location, and operators enforce these through IP verification alongside account registration details. Age verification remains mandatory, and minimum deposit thresholds apply to activate certain offers. Maximum bet limits during bonus playthrough prevent large single wagers from accelerating requirements unfairly.
Regional Regulatory Approaches in Mid-2026
Regulators in the United States monitor bonus promotions through state gaming commissions, and data from the Nevada Gaming Control Board indicates steady growth in reported promotional spend during the first half of the year. Canadian provincial authorities apply similar oversight, requiring clear disclosure of terms on operator sites while Australian state regulators emphasize consumer protection measures that cap bonus values in certain markets. European frameworks vary by country, with emphasis on responsible gaming messaging integrated into bonus presentations.
August 2026 updates in several jurisdictions introduced standardized reporting templates for bonus statistics, allowing better comparison across operators. These changes followed industry consultations that addressed player complaints about hidden restrictions. Industry associations such as the American Gaming Association have published guidelines that encourage consistent terminology in bonus descriptions to reduce confusion.
